org.kuali.kpme.tklm.leave.override.service
Class EmployeeOverrideServiceImpl

java.lang.Object
  extended by org.kuali.kpme.tklm.leave.override.service.EmployeeOverrideServiceImpl
All Implemented Interfaces:
EmployeeOverrideService

public class EmployeeOverrideServiceImpl
extends Object
implements EmployeeOverrideService


Constructor Summary
EmployeeOverrideServiceImpl()
           
 
Method Summary
 EmployeeOverride getEmployeeOverride(String lmEmployeeOverrideId)
           
 EmployeeOverride getEmployeeOverride(String principalId, String leavePlan, String accrualCategory, String overrideType, org.joda.time.LocalDate asOfDate)
           
 EmployeeOverrideDao getEmployeeOverrideDao()
           
 List<EmployeeOverride> getEmployeeOverrides(String principalId, org.joda.time.LocalDate asOfDate)
           
 List<EmployeeOverride> getEmployeeOverrides(String principalId, String leavePlan, String accrualCategory, String overrideType, org.joda.time.LocalDate fromEffdt, org.joda.time.LocalDate toEffdt, String active)
           
 void setEmployeeOverrideDao(EmployeeOverrideDao employeeOverrideDao)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

EmployeeOverrideServiceImpl

public EmployeeOverrideServiceImpl()
Method Detail

getEmployeeOverrides

public List<EmployeeOverride> getEmployeeOverrides(String principalId,
                                                   org.joda.time.LocalDate asOfDate)
Specified by:
getEmployeeOverrides in interface EmployeeOverrideService

getEmployeeOverride

public EmployeeOverride getEmployeeOverride(String principalId,
                                            String leavePlan,
                                            String accrualCategory,
                                            String overrideType,
                                            org.joda.time.LocalDate asOfDate)
Specified by:
getEmployeeOverride in interface EmployeeOverrideService

getEmployeeOverride

public EmployeeOverride getEmployeeOverride(String lmEmployeeOverrideId)
Specified by:
getEmployeeOverride in interface EmployeeOverrideService

getEmployeeOverrides

public List<EmployeeOverride> getEmployeeOverrides(String principalId,
                                                   String leavePlan,
                                                   String accrualCategory,
                                                   String overrideType,
                                                   org.joda.time.LocalDate fromEffdt,
                                                   org.joda.time.LocalDate toEffdt,
                                                   String active)
Specified by:
getEmployeeOverrides in interface EmployeeOverrideService

getEmployeeOverrideDao

public EmployeeOverrideDao getEmployeeOverrideDao()

setEmployeeOverrideDao

public void setEmployeeOverrideDao(EmployeeOverrideDao employeeOverrideDao)


Copyright © 2004-2014 The Kuali Foundation. All Rights Reserved.